Elon Musk appeared to take a massive swipe at Donald Trump over his foreign policy in Greenland and Venezuela on Thursday. Musk made a surprsie appearance at World Economic Forum in Davos after publicly criticising the annual gathering of political and business elites for years.

Speaking at the summit, Mr Musk took a dig at the US President and said: « I heard about the peace summit. I was like, is that “P-I-E-C-E?” You know, a little piece of Greenland, a little piece of Venezuela. »
